    Oliver Wyman is a global leader in management consulting. With offices in more than 70 cities across 30 countries, Oliver Wyman combines deep industry knowledge with specialized expertise in strategy, operations, risk management, and organization transformation. The firm has more than 5,000 professionals around the world who work with clients to optimize their business, improve their operations and risk profile, and accelerate their organizational performance to seize the most attractive opportunities.

    The Director of Internal Communications for Europe proactively develops and executes the internal communications and colleague engagement strategy for the European Region (11 countries, 2800 colleagues) working closely with the European Region leaders, European Market leaders; the Executive Director, Global Internal communications; and members of the European Business Impact Team. The successful candidate will also proactively lead and collaborate on global strategic communication initiatives with our global leadership teams and other functional leaders on internal communications strategies.

    Specifically, you'll be responsible for:

    Collaboratively developing and executing internal communication and colleague engagement strategies with senior leaders; launching and maintaining new and innovative campaigns and channels

    • Working closely with the firm's senior leaders in Europe, to help colleagues feel informed, engaged, and a sense of pride and belonging.
    • Developing creative ways to increase engagement, build trust, and encourage greater knowledge sharing and collaboration
    • Recommending and developing communications campaigns for diverse topics and programs using creative techniques; function as the conductor of the orchestra, working closely with the Business Impact Team, Human Capital, Marketing, Inclusion & Diversity, and internal Creative Studio teams.

    Enabling and supporting strong connectivity across the European region, its Markets, and globally to enhance our culture and support the flow of information

    • Working closely with European Leadership Team and Executive Director, Internal Communications on strategies and techniques to achieve this.
    • Leading and supporting global and regional initiatives, as needed, including internal competitions and awards programs, developing, and overseeing live virtual talks, podcast and video production, or other multi-media efforts.
    • Independently identifying issues and opportunities for improvement and innovation and provide compelling and well thought out solutions to problems of high complexity.
    • Overseeing measurement / reporting on campaigns, budgetary spend and measure and analyze the success of communications activities.
    • Undertaking campaigns, program reviews, and take learning into future campaigns and programs.

    Content Development / Writing and Editing

    • Ghost writing for senior leaders in various parts of the business as needed.
    • Sourcing and developing content for regional Managing Partners (in-person / virtual events, video, etc.)
    • Using digital storytelling and other creative techniques to bring our people and culture to life such as humor, infographics, light-hearted internal competitions, gamification, brainteasers, listicles, as well as short form articles.

    Crisis Communication and Issues Management

    • In the event of a crisis or issue management situation, leading and driving the response in Europe in coordination with the Executive Director, Internal Communications; Europe Region leaders; and other involved internal stakeholders with all required steps and actions: action plan development, talking points, Q&As, etc.
